numCoresToUse (ו- rxOptions, באופן כללי) קשורה רק הגדרת מיחשוב מבוזר עבור פונקציות RevoScaleR. foreach ו- doParallel לא להשתמש בו. כדי להריץ את הסקריפט שלך במצב מקבילית, יהיה עליך להירשם תחילה עורפי מקבילי לפקודה foreach שלך. במקום numCoresToUse הגדרה, להשתמש
library(doParallel} registerDoParallel(cores=6)
getDoParWorkers() אמור לחזור 6 בנקודה זו. הדבר מגדיר "אשכולות מחשוב" על-פני כל ליבה, שכל אחד מהם יכול להפעיל תהליך R ולהעביר מעל sockets עם אחרים.
כמה משאבים נוספים על השימוש foreach ו- doParallel שתסביר אפשרויות נוספות על הפעלה במקביל:
http://cran.r-project.org/web/packages/foreach/vignettes/foreach.pdf
http://cran.r-project.org/web/packages/doParallel/vignettes/gettingstartedParallel.pdf